# --- Settings: Password Reset Revamp (read me, support team) ---
# The old email-token flow is gone. Resets now go through the
# Keylatch verification service: user requests reset, gets a
# six-digit code, code expires in 10 minutes. If a customer
# reports a stuck reset, check the reset_attempts table for
# their recent entries before escalating. The attempts table
# lives in the auth store; connect with the string below.

primary connection of yagep-kahip = redis://giliel_svc:zYiKsLL2PLpfPL@db-348f.xolmarsys.corp:5432/fenwyn

## Meridica Sync 4.1 — Changed Defaults

The calendar sync engine now resolves conflicting edits using last-writer-wins with a server-side tiebreak, replacing the previous prompt-the-user default. Field feedback showed users dismissed the prompt without reading it, so silent resolution with an audit trail is safer in practice. Declined-event tombstones are also retained longer by default to prevent resurrection bugs. Release manager: note that upgraded instances adopt the new defaults automatically, shown in full below.

config for bahip-kawip:
zorwyn:
  pin: 7487
  tenant: zorys
  seal: seal_97c3f2b9
  metrics_host: metrics.zorwyn.novacworks.corp
  standby_team: rusael
  escalation: casok-eliok
  nonce: 74acb6

# Environment Variables — Spindlecycle Rebalancer

The rebalancing tool reads dock occupancy every five minutes and plans truck routes overnight. Core settings: REBALANCE_WINDOW (hours), MIN_DOCK_FILL (fraction), and FLEET_SIZE. All live in the service env file. The routing API requires authentication, and its credential is set on the line directly below.

secret setting of tajog-bafog: RELAY_SECRET13=8f6af7680fb2b